Oil Shock: Gas Prices Top 2008 Levels

Cheapest gas in San Juan Capistrano is $3.79 at the Shell on Ortega Highway.

The average price of a gallon of self-serve regular gasoline in Orange County rose 3.5 cents Saturday to $3.694, its highest amount since Sept. 19, 2008.

No surprise here: Gas in San Juan Capistrano is even more expensive. According to the latest prices listed on GasBuddy.com, the cheapest gas is $3.79 per gallon.

The average Orange County price is 15.7 cents more than a week ago, 34.8 cents higher than one month ago and 72 cents above what it was one year ago, according to figures from the AAA and Oil Price Information Service.

The Orange County average price has also increased 24 of the last 25 days, including 6.3 cents Friday.

"Continued Middle East tension has pushed oil prices to levels not seen since 2008, which was the only other year prices were this high,'' said Jeffrey Spring of the Automobile Club of Southern California.

The price of a barrel of Brent crude oil, which is used to price the imported oil used by California refineries, on the ICE Futures exchange in London rose 72 cents Friday to $112.14.

Crude oil costs account for two-thirds to three-quarters of the price of a gallon of gasoline, according to Tupper Hull, vice president of strategic communications for the Western States Petroleum Association, a trade association representing oil companies in six western states.
